begin process at 2012 05 28 07:34:53
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ive C/C++

 > 

Archives

 > 

Au secours

 > 

D'une AnsiString à un Tableau de char


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

D'une AnsiString à un Tableau de char

lundi 17 octobre 2005 à 19:07:53 | D'une AnsiString à un Tableau de char

sevenace

Bonjour à tous,

Mon AnsiString provient d'un EditBox. Je récupère le nombre de caractères comme ça:

    AnsiString chaine = EditChaine->Text;
    int taille = chaine.Length();

Et maintenant je voudrais mettre tous mes caractères dans un tableau de char.

Exemple:
Edit: azerty
chaine = azerty
taille = 6

char Chaine[7];

Maintenant je ne sais pas comment prendre chaque caractère et les mettre dans mon tableau?

Merci d'avance

$€v€n'@c€

lundi 17 octobre 2005 à 20:37:12 | Re : D'une AnsiString à un Tableau de char

BruNews

Administrateur CodeS-SourceS
GetWindowText te donnerait illico le résultat dans un char[] et te donnerait le nbr inséré de caractères.
Regarde si tu peux ressortir un hwnd de ton bidule EditChaine.

ciao...
BruNews, MVP VC++
mardi 18 octobre 2005 à 08:01:55 | Re : D'une AnsiString à un Tableau de char

fredcl

Réponse acceptée !
Bonjour,

la fonction membre c_str() de l'objet AnsiString donne un pointeur sur char (char*) il faut après utiliserbune foonction de copy de tableau de char.

Cordialement


Fred Cailleau-Lepetit (http://cfred.free.fr)



Cette discussion est classée dans : chaine, tableau, ansistring, char, caractères


Répondre à ce message

Sujets en rapport avec ce message

tableau de chaines de char [ par JaguiJaguar ] Salut, je suis etudiant.je dois réaliser un prog en c qui lit une chaine de char, la stocke dans la premiere ligne d'un tableau char *tab[n]où n est l chaine de caractères.... [ par Clonk ] Bonjour,Voilà, j'ai un problème depuis hier sur uen histoire de chaine de caractères... je sais que c'est une erreur bête, mais je n'arrive pas à trou chaines de caractères dans un tableau char a 2 dimensions [ par deck_bsd ] Bonjour a tous, voila J'ai un fichier qui contient des mots (1sur une ligne différente) et je voudrai bien copier chacun de ces mots dans un tableau remplir un tableau avec des chaines de caractères (C) [ par djibfr ] Bonjour à tous! Alors voila, j'ai un petit problème tout bête mais je n'arrive pas à la résoudre et mes recheches ne m'ont pas trop éclairé. Je souhai Besoin d'aide. [ par lui88 ] j'ai quelque soucis avec des erreurs que j'arrive pas a corrigéerror C2200:avertissement considere comme une erreur-aucun fichier genere.Warning C4996 tableau de chaine de caractère [ par delaktn ] salut, Je réalise une application dont je besoin d'un tableau de chaine de caractère et voila la déclaration de ce tableau: char* t[10]; j'ai réalisé analyse syntaxique [ par fadiam ] Bonjour à tous. je cherche à réaliser une fonction qui modifie une chaine de caractères.elle n'accepte que les "chiffres" de 0 à 9 et quelques autres Chaine de caractères et liste de mots [ par joshua509 ] J'ai un gros problème d'algorithme. Comment faire pour placer,tous les mots séparer d'un espace d'une chaine de caractère,dans une liste chainée de mo Initialiser un tableau [ par ndubien ] Bonjour, je souhaiterais initialiser ma variable Chemins mais ne sais pas comment faire: char **Chemins = (char**) calloc ( nbElements, sizeof(char)*M Extraire entier d'une chaine [ par Vylco ] Bonjour, voila j'ai un exo a faire en algo mais je vois pas comment le faire. la consigne: soit une chaine de caractère. Ecrivez une fonction qui rec


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 2,605 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ales